What the day feels like

What the Morning Feels Like

You’ll be collected from your Mexico City accommodation in the predawn—around 4:30–5:00 AM—and driven roughly 50 minutes to the launch area. As the crew prepares the balloons you’ll have coffee, tea and cookies, then board for a 40–60 minute shared flight. After touching down, the group moves to a local restaurant for a traditional breakfast and toast, then spends about 1.45 hours on a guided tour of the archaeological site before returning to Mexico City for drop‑off.

Frequently asked questions

Planning Your Outing

How long is the whole experience?

The total trip runs approximately ten hours from pickup to drop‑off.

When and where do we meet?

You will be picked up from your accommodation in Mexico City at about 4:30–5:00 AM; travel time to Teotihuacan is roughly 50 minutes.

How long is the balloon flight?

The shared hot-air balloon flight lasts about 40 to 60 minutes.

Are there age or weight restrictions?

Minimum age to fly is 4 years (or 1.20 m tall). Children 4–10 qualify for the child rate if they weigh no more than 45 kg (100 lbs). The operator’s maximum weight limit is 110 kg (240 lbs); contact them if you are near that limit.

Is the trip suitable for pregnant people or those with back problems?

The experience is not recommended for pregnant women and people with chronic back pains.

What’s included in the price?

Included are the shared balloon flight, flight insurance, breakfast at a local restaurant, traditional toast, a guided archaeological tour (about 1.45 hours), pyramid tickets, and round‑trip transport from your accommodation.

Are gratuities included?

No — gratuities are not included.
